I've just taken possession of a very nice Zorki 6 in super condition. It is cosmetically very clean and all functions operate but the film winding mechanism is very stiff and jerks at times, typical of hardened grease in the gearing etc. Does anybody know how I can remedy this problem or of a good website for info etc?
